- By Kiwi Commerce
- 31 Dec, 2025
- Magento 2
Magento 2 Inventory: Best Practises to Improve Order Fulfillment
Inventory issues are one of the most common reasons for delayed deliveries, cancelled orders and unhappy customers. Even established retailers struggle with inaccurate stock levels, especially as product ranges grow and fulfilment becomes more complex.
Magento 2 provides a powerful inventory management system designed to give better stock visibility, streamline fulfilment and reduce costly errors. When set up and managed correctly, it can significantly improve how quickly and accurately orders reach customers.
In this guide, we explore how Magento 2 inventory works and the best practises you can follow to optimise order fulfilment.
Understanding Magento 2 Inventory Management
Magento 2 offers a flexible inventory framework that supports everything from single-warehouse stores to businesses operating across multiple locations. The system helps merchants track stock in real time, allocate inventory intelligently and automate key fulfilment processes.
At its core, Magento 2 inventory management is about accuracy, visibility and control.
Stock Management in Magento 2
Magento 2 stock management provides real-time insights into inventory levels across your entire catalog. You can track what is available, reserved for orders, or running low, helping you make informed fulfillment decisions.
Key benefits include:
- Real-time inventory updates
- Bulk and individual stock adjustments
- Clear in-stock, out-of-stock, and backorder settings
- Detailed visibility at the SKU level
Accurate stock data is the foundation of reliable order fulfillment, ensuring smooth operations and satisfied customers.
Product Attributes and Variations
Magento allows you to define detailed product attributes such as size, color, weight, and availability. These attributes are especially useful when managing configurable products or large catalogs.
Clear product data helps:
- Reduce picking and packing errors
- Improve warehouse efficiency
- Enhance customer search and filtering
Well-structured product variations lead to smoother fulfillment operations.
Multi-Source Inventory (MSI) and Warehouse Management
Magento 2’s Multi-Source Inventory (MSI) feature allows businesses to manage stock across multiple warehouses, stores, or fulfillment partners.
With MSI, you can:
- Assign inventory to multiple sources
- Automatically route orders to the best location
- Reduce delivery times and shipping costs
- Avoid unnecessary order splitting
For growing businesses, MSI plays a key role in scaling fulfillment efficiently.
Integration with External Systems
Magento 2 integrates with ERP systems, POS platforms, shipping providers and third-party logistics tools. These integrations ensure inventory data remains consistent across all channels.
When integrations are properly maintained, they eliminate manual updates and prevent fulfilment delays caused by data mismatches.
Setting Up Inventory in Magento 2
To get the most from Magento 2 inventory management, correct configuration is essential.
Important setup steps include:
- Defining minimum and maximum stock levels
- Setting low-stock thresholds and alerts
- Limiting purchase quantities where necessary
- Assigning products to the correct inventory sources
You can also enable stock notifications to inform customers when products are back in stock, helping recover missed sales opportunities.
Managing Stock Movements and Returns
Magento 2 tracks inventory movements across purchases, sales, transfers and adjustments. This visibility helps businesses understand how stock flows through the fulfilment process.
Returns and refunds can also be managed efficiently through structured workflows, ensuring stock levels remain accurate and returned items are handled correctly.
Advanced Inventory Strategies in Magento 2
Magento 2 supports several advanced inventory strategies that improve fulfillment flexibility:
- Bundled products: Move multiple items together while tracking individual components accurately
- Dropshipping: Allow suppliers to ship directly to customers without holding physical stock
- Backorders and pre-orders: Enable customers to reserve products that are out of stock or yet to be released
When used transparently, these strategies improve customer experience and demand forecasting.
Tips for Effective Magento Inventory Management
To maximise the benefits of Magento 2 inventory management and improve order fulfilment, consider the following best practises:
Keep Inventory Data Accurate
Ensure SKUs, attributes and stock statuses are consistent across your catalogue. Clean data reduces fulfilment errors and confusion in the warehouse.
Enable Real-Time Stock Updates
Real-time updates prevent overselling and ensure customers only purchase available products, especially during high-traffic periods.
Set Low-Stock Alerts and Reorder Points
Use Magento’s alerts to stay ahead of stock shortages. Reorder points based on sales velocity help maintain consistent fulfilment.
Use Multi-Source Inventory Strategically
Prioritise fulfilment locations that reduce delivery times and shipping costs. Proper source assignment improves order routing efficiency.
Automate Inventory Processes
Automation reduces manual errors and speeds up fulfilment. Stock deductions, order allocation and alerts should all be automated where possible.
Monitor Inventory Movement
Regularly review stock movement reports to identify slow-moving items, discrepancies or operational inefficiencies.
Handle Returns Carefully
Ensure returned items are only added back to stock once inspected and approved. This keeps available inventory accurate.
Integrate All Sales Channels
Keep Magento synced with ERP, POS and logistics systems to maintain a single source of truth for inventory data.
Use Reports to Improve Decisions
Magento’s reporting tools help analyse stock turnover, product performance and fulfilment trends.
Perform Regular Inventory Audits
Even with automation, physical checks remain essential. Cycle counts help identify issues early and maintain confidence in stock data.
Common Inventory Challenges and How to Avoid Them
Some common issues businesses face include stock discrepancies, integration sync problems and unexpected stockouts. Regular audits, monitored integrations and proactive replenishment planning help prevent these problems before they impact fulfilment.
Final Thoughts
Magento 2 inventory management plays a critical role in delivering fast, accurate and reliable order fulfilment. When inventory is configured correctly and supported by the right processes, businesses can reduce delays, prevent stock issues and meet customer expectations with confidence.
From real-time stock updates and Multi-Source Inventory to automation and reporting, Magento provides the tools needed to manage inventory at scale. However, unlocking their full potential often requires expert planning, configuration and ongoing optimisation.
KiwiCommerce specialises in Magento development and custom eCommerce solutions, helping businesses design, optimise and scale Magento stores for long-term growth. Our Magento development experts work closely with merchants to build inventory workflows that improve fulfilment efficiency, reduce operational friction and support business expansion.
Whether you need help configuring Magento 2 inventory, implementing Multi-Source Inventory, integrating third-party systems or optimising your store for high-volume order fulfilment, KiwiCommerce delivers tailored Magento development solutions that drive real results.